Three pink Pelargonium patulum flowers make up this cluster. The solid, dark purple patches on the upper petals are almost black in their centres. White markings are visible just below these, as well as some narrow lateral lines, purplish in colour, completing the upper petal embellishments. The flowers are borne on pedicels shorter than the flower tubes.

The plant may flower during most of the year, less in late autumn and winter. This photo was taken in October (Manning, 2007; Bond and Goldblatt, 1984; iNaturalist; iSpot; JSTOR).
